From: Adolf Belka Date: Mon, 8 Sep 2025 12:59:38 +0000 (+0200) Subject: backup.pl: Update the RW entry in collectd.vpn if restoring old backup X-Git-Tag: v2.29-core197~1 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=0088442c56e8a623c25d1a93940eabd29e4d430b;p=ipfire-2.x.git backup.pl: Update the RW entry in collectd.vpn if restoring old backup Signed-off-by: Adolf Belka Signed-off-by: Michael Tremer --- diff --git a/config/backup/backup.pl b/config/backup/backup.pl index e79f510c6..8988427ea 100644 --- a/config/backup/backup.pl +++ b/config/backup/backup.pl @@ -349,8 +349,12 @@ restore_backup() { rm /var/log/pakfire.log fi - # Update the OpenVPN configuration and restart the openvpn daemons + # Update the OpenVPN configuration, update the RW log entry in collectd.vpn + # if it is the old name and restart the openvpn daemons sudo -u nobody /srv/web/ipfire/cgi-bin/ovpnmain.cgi + if grep -q "/var/run/ovpnserver.log" /var/ipfire/ovpn/collectd.vpn; then + sed -i 's|"/var/run/ovpnserver.log"|"/var/run/openvpn-rw.log"|' /var/ipfire/ovpn/collectd.vpn + fi /etc/init.d/openvpn-n2n restart /etc/init.d/openvpn-rw restart